The Role
You will manage a varied caseload of private client matters, providing clear and practical advice to a broad client base. The role offers a balance of autonomy and collaboration, with exposure to a wide range of work including estate planning and wealth protection.

Key responsibilities will include:

  • Managing a full caseload of private client matters from instruction to completion
  • Drafting wills, trusts, and lasting powers of attorney
  • Advising on probate and estate administration
  • Providing guidance on inheritance tax and estate planning matters
  • Supporting clients with Court of Protection and deputyship work where required
  • Maintaining strong client relationships and delivering high levels of client care
  • Ensuring compliance with regulatory and file management requirements
  • Assisting with business development and networking activities
